Chlorine tablets are the standard way to sanitize your pool water by slowly releasing chlorine as they dissolve in a feeder or floater. You need them to keep your water clear and free of bacteria and algae. Using them correctly is a core part of keeping your pool healthy and safe for swimmers throughout the season. Can an existing pool in Cambridge be remodeled without a full excavation?

Yes, in Cambridge, an existing pool can often be remodeled without a full excavation, which is a common and cost-effective approach. The process typically involves draining the pool, preparing the existing surface through cleaning and possibly etching or sandblasting, and then applying a new finish. This method effectively revitalizes the pool's appearance and addresses surface-level issues while preserving the original shell and significantly reducing project complexity and expense.

How does regular pool maintenance impact the need for resurfacing in Cambridge?

Regular and diligent pool maintenance in Cambridge plays a crucial role in extending the life of your pool's surface and delaying the need for resurfacing. Proper water chemistry balancing prevents etching and scaling, which can degrade plaster over time. Consistent cleaning removes debris that can cause staining. Neglecting these routine tasks accelerates wear and tear, potentially leading to premature deterioration of finishes and requiring more extensive and costly resurfacing sooner than if the pool were properly cared for.
